Replacing your water heater with an energy-efficient heat pump model near you, such as those offered in Albany, can significantly impact your energy bills and environmental footprint. Heat pump water heaters are becoming increasingly popular for their ability to provide hot water while using less energy than traditional gas or electric resistance heaters. In fact, they can save households up to 50% on water heating costs, offering substantial long-term savings. For example, a study by the U.S. Department of Energy found that heat pump water heaters can reduce greenhouse gas emissions by up to 40% compared to standard electric water heaters.

Choosing the right heat pump water heater involves understanding different types and their capabilities. Unlike traditional gas heaters, which convert fuel into heat, heat pump systems transfer heat from one location to another using a refrigerant cycle. This process allows them to extract heat even when the outdoor temperature is cold.
